True Love: The Sequel

Premise here is photos are taken and arranged in story with cartoon-like dialogue. There are three stories, each one involving love/romance. The stories are deliberately corny and fake, which makes them kinda charming in a strange sort of way. The tales – like the one in which a guy’s roommate sabotages his date, or the one in which a guy is dating two girls on the same night and is found out – seem to be commenting on the state of the romance narrative in pop culture, implicitly referencing everything from Archie to Three’s Company to the Harlequin. Maybe I’m reading too much into this. (Hal Niedzviecki)
